在当今信息化社会中,以计算机信息技术为代表的新一轮信息化建设已经成为当今社会各个领域的共同特征。各种信息技术的迅速发展为高校毕业生信息收集分析反馈提供了有利条件。开发和设计的毕业生信息收集反馈系统是这个时代的产物,利用计算机支持管理者高效率管理,节省人力资源的目的,解决因为传统毕业生信息收集分析反馈管理的局限性。本系统内容丰富,包括阅卷调查和毕业生论坛等。
本网站是在Windows XP环境下,采用B/S结构,以MySQL为数据库开发平台,用Apache服务器为应用服务器,采用PHP语言开发和设计的。系统分前台和后台两大部分,前台由用户使用,主要包括站内新闻等功能模块;后台部分由管理员使用,主要包括系统用户管理等功能模块。
关键词:PHP;毕业生信息;MySQL
Abstract
In today's information society, computer information technology as the representative of the new round of informatization construction has become a common feature in each field of the society. The rapid development of information technology for college graduates to collect and analyze information feedback provides favorable conditions. The development and design of the graduates information feedback system is a product of this era, the use of computer support management efficient management, save manpower resources, solve for traditional graduate information collection and analysis the limitations of feedback management. The system is rich in content, including the questionaires and Graduate Forum etc..
This site is in the Windows XP environment, using B/S structure, using MySQL database development platform, using Apache server as the application server, using PHP language development and design. The system is divided into two parts, the onstage and the backstage, front desk by the users, including station news functions; background in part by the administrators, including user management system function module.
Keywords: PHP; MySQL graduates information;
目 录
1.绪论 6
1.1课题研究目的和意义 6
2.系统分析 6
2.1可行性分析 6
2.1.1技术可行性分析 6
2.1.2经济可行性分析 7
2.1.3操作可行性分析 7
2.2功能需求分析 7
2.3业务流程分析 8
2.4数据流程分析 10
3.系统设计 11
3.1系统设计原则 11
3.2系统结构设计 11
3.3系统开发工具 12
3.2.1 PHP技术 12
3.2.2 MySQL Server 13
3.2.3 Macromedia Dreamweaver 8 14
3.3.4 Apache 15
4.数据库设计 16
4.1数据库设计的原则 16
4.2数据库概念设计(E-R图) 17
4.3数据表设计 18
5.系统界面操作说明 21
5.1前台操作说明 22
5.1.1网站首页 22
5.1.2 问卷调查页面 22
5.1.3在线留言页面 25
5.1.4在线论坛查看页面 26
5.1.5帖子查看页面 27
5.1.6发表新帖页面 28
5.2后台操作说明 29
5.2.1管理员后台登陆页面 29
5.2.2管理员添加页面 32
5.2.3站内新闻添加页面 32
5.2.4站内新闻查询页面 35
5.2.5论坛板块添加页面 37
5.2.6所有帖子管理页面 39
5.2.7毕业生信息添加页面 39
6.软件测试与分析 40
6.1系统测试的定义 40
6.2系统测试的目的及意义 40
6.3系统测试的重要性 41
6.4系统测试的常用方法 41
6.5测试环境与测试条件 42
6.6系统运行情况 42
6.7测试总结 43
7.结论 43
7.1系统的特点 43
7.2系统的不足和改进 43
7.3设计收获与心得 44
致谢 45
参考文献 46
1.绪论
1.1课题研究目的和意义
随着科学技术的飞速发展和革新,人民生活中的各项活动似乎都离不开计算机和网络技术,“万能”的计算机几乎能够自动完成所有的工作。随着计算机与网络技术的普及,最大限度的帮助人们节省时间和提高工作效率,引领先进领先技术的高校更应该将计算机与网络技术推广到校园中。先进的计算机和网络技术有着人工手动无法超越的优点,例如:智能化、节省时间、节省人力、节约开支、数据保密性强、方便管理等。它能最大限度的提高管理者和工作人员的效率,把他们从繁杂的事物中解脱出来。开发和设计的毕业生信息收集分析反馈系统,是一个支持毕业生信息收集、分析、处理和反馈的信息系统,主要服务于学科专业对毕业生的就业、工作情况的了解;对所接受的专业教育(专业培养方案)的意见和建议;社会对人才的需求和评价信息收集,处理,从而指导专业培养方案的完善和教育质量的提高。
所以研发一套能切实提高高校毕业生信息收集管理者工作效率、适应新时代发展脚步的毕业生信息收集分析反馈系统是一件具有重大意义的事情。